Financial Aid
Duke University School of Medicine makes financial assistance available to accepted students who, due to economic circumstances, could not otherwise attend the university. The school recognizes, however, the responsibility of the individual and the family to provide funds to achieve the objective of your education. Therefore, the cost of attending the School of Medicine is a responsibility shared by the student, the parents, and the school.
